Articles

How To Beat Trace

How to Beat Trace: Mastering the Art of Outsmarting Tracking and Surveillance how to beat trace is a question that has become increasingly relevant in today’s d...

How to Beat Trace: Mastering the Art of Outsmarting Tracking and Surveillance how to beat trace is a question that has become increasingly relevant in today’s digital age. With the proliferation of online tracking, data surveillance, and sophisticated tracing techniques, many people are seeking effective ways to maintain their privacy and avoid being tracked, whether it be by advertisers, hackers, or even more intrusive entities. Understanding the mechanics behind tracing and learning practical methods to beat it can empower you to protect your personal information and maintain greater control over your digital footprint.

Understanding Trace and Tracking Techniques

Before diving into strategies on how to beat trace, it’s essential to grasp what tracing entails in the context of technology and online activity. Tracing generally refers to the process of identifying or tracking a user’s actions, location, or identity through various digital means. This can be done via IP addresses, browser fingerprinting, cookies, GPS data, or even behavioral analytics.

Common Methods Used to Trace Individuals

  • **IP Address Tracking:** Every device connected to the internet has an IP address, which can reveal general location information and be used to track user behavior.
  • **Browser Fingerprinting:** Websites collect unique data points about your browser and device setup to create a fingerprint that helps identify and track you across sessions.
  • **Cookies and Tracking Pixels:** These small data files and invisible images monitor your activities on websites and often follow you from one site to another.
  • **GPS and Location Data:** Apps and services frequently request location access to track your real-world movements.
  • **Network Surveillance:** ISPs and network administrators can monitor traffic flow and usage patterns to trace online activity.
Understanding these techniques helps in identifying vulnerabilities and applying targeted countermeasures.

How to Beat Trace: Practical Strategies for Privacy

The good news is that there are multiple ways to defend yourself against tracing efforts. By combining smart digital habits with the right tools, you can significantly reduce your traceability online.

Use Virtual Private Networks (VPNs)

A VPN is one of the most effective tools to mask your IP address and encrypt your internet traffic. When you connect through a VPN server, your real IP is hidden behind the VPN’s IP, making it far harder for trackers to pinpoint your location or identify your device.
  • Choose a reputable VPN provider that does not keep logs.
  • Opt for servers in privacy-friendly countries.
  • Avoid free VPNs, as they often compromise privacy or sell user data.

Leverage Privacy-Focused Browsers and Search Engines

Standard browsers and search engines often collect significant amounts of data. Switching to more privacy-conscious alternatives can help you beat trace efforts.
  • **Browsers:** Firefox with privacy extensions, Brave, or Tor Browser offer better protections against fingerprinting and tracking.
  • **Search Engines:** DuckDuckGo and Startpage don’t track your queries or create user profiles.

Manage and Block Cookies and Trackers

Cookies are a common way websites trace users. By managing cookie settings and employing tracker blockers, you can limit the amount of data collected about your browsing habits.
  • Regularly clear cookies and cache.
  • Use browser extensions like uBlock Origin, Privacy Badger, or Ghostery.
  • Enable “Do Not Track” settings, though not all sites honor them.

Be Mindful of Your Device Settings

Many devices collect and transmit location and usage data by default. Adjusting privacy settings can help you restrict this.
  • Disable location services when not necessary.
  • Turn off ad tracking on smartphones.
  • Review app permissions regularly and restrict access to sensitive data.

Employ Anonymous Communication Tools

To beat trace on messaging or email platforms, consider using encrypted and anonymous communication tools.
  • Use Signal or Telegram for encrypted messaging.
  • Create email accounts through providers like ProtonMail or Tutanota that prioritize privacy.
  • Avoid sharing identifying information in communications.

Utilize Tor Network for Anonymity

The Tor network routes your internet traffic through multiple servers worldwide, making it extremely difficult to trace the origin of your connection. It’s widely used by privacy advocates and journalists.
  • Use the Tor Browser for anonymous browsing.
  • Be cautious about what information you share, as Tor doesn’t encrypt data beyond exit nodes.
  • Avoid logging into personal accounts while using Tor to maintain anonymity.

Advanced Techniques to Beat Trace

For those seeking a deeper level of privacy and anonymity, there are more advanced methods that can help evade sophisticated tracing tools.

Browser Fingerprint Spoofing

Since browser fingerprinting collects detailed information about your system, spoofing or randomizing these data points can confuse trackers.
  • Use extensions like CanvasBlocker or Random User-Agent.
  • Regularly change browser configurations or use specialized browsers designed to minimize fingerprinting.

Use Disposable and Burners for Digital Footprints

Creating temporary accounts or using burner phones and devices can help compartmentalize your activities, making it harder to link actions back to you.
  • Use temporary email services for registrations.
  • Operate from different devices or profiles for sensitive tasks.

Employ End-to-End Encryption for Data in Transit

Encrypting your communications and data ensures that even if intercepted, the information remains unreadable.
  • Use encrypted messaging apps.
  • Employ VPNs and HTTPS connections.
  • Encrypt files and storage devices.

Behavioral Tactics to Reduce Traceability

Sometimes, beating trace isn’t just about technology but about how you behave online and offline.

Limit Sharing Personal Information

Oversharing details on social media or forums can create a digital trail that’s easy to follow.
  • Avoid posting location data, schedules, or personal identifiers.
  • Use pseudonyms or anonymous profiles when possible.

Vary Your Online Patterns

Consistent patterns in browsing hours, device usage, or online activities make it easier to create profiles.
  • Change your browsing times and habits.
  • Use different devices or networks.
  • Clear history and caches regularly.

Be Wary of Public Wi-Fi

Public networks are vulnerable to eavesdropping and tracking.
  • Avoid accessing sensitive accounts on public Wi-Fi.
  • Always use a VPN when connecting through insecure networks.

Why Beating Trace Matters Beyond Privacy

While privacy is often seen as a personal matter, beating trace has broader implications. It safeguards freedom of expression, protects against identity theft, and helps maintain autonomy in an increasingly surveilled world. Whether you are a journalist, activist, or simply a concerned internet user, understanding how to beat trace empowers you to take back control over your digital life. In summary, beating trace involves a mix of technological tools, smart habits, and awareness of how data flows online. By implementing VPNs, privacy-centric browsers, encrypted communication, and mindful behavior, you significantly reduce your digital footprint and make tracing your activities far more challenging. As tracking technologies evolve, staying informed and adapting your strategies is the key to staying one step ahead.

FAQ

What is 'trace' in programming, and why might someone want to beat it?

+

In programming, 'trace' typically refers to tracking or logging the execution of a program to debug or monitor its behavior. Someone might want to beat or bypass trace mechanisms to prevent reverse engineering, protect intellectual property, or avoid detection in security contexts.

How can I detect if my application is being traced?

+

You can detect tracing by checking for debugging flags, monitoring system calls like ptrace on Linux, or detecting the presence of debugging tools and breakpoints within your application's runtime environment.

What are common methods to prevent or beat tracing in software?

+

Common methods include obfuscating code, using anti-debugging techniques such as ptrace detection, timing checks to detect delays caused by tracing, encrypting sensitive parts of code, and employing runtime integrity checks.

How does ptrace work, and how can it be circumvented?

+

Ptrace is a system call in Unix-like systems that allows one process to observe and control another, often used for debugging. To circumvent ptrace, software can detect if ptrace is attached and terminate or alter behavior, or use techniques like ptrace hiding or employing anti-debugging tricks.

Can hardware breakpoints be used to trace code execution, and how to counter them?

+

Yes, hardware breakpoints can be set by debuggers to trace code execution at the hardware level. To counter them, software can check debug registers or use timing checks to identify the presence of breakpoints and react accordingly.

Are there ethical concerns related to beating trace or anti-debugging techniques?

+

Yes, using methods to beat tracing or anti-debugging can be ethically questionable if used for malicious purposes such as hiding malware or unauthorized software manipulation. However, these techniques are also used legitimately to protect software intellectual property and enhance security.

What tools exist to help developers implement anti-tracing mechanisms?

+

Tools like Obfuscators, packers, code protectors, and specialized anti-debugging libraries help developers implement anti-tracing mechanisms. Examples include Themida, VMProtect, and open-source anti-debug libraries for various programming languages.

How effective are timing checks in detecting tracing or debugging?

+

Timing checks can be moderately effective because tracing or debugging often introduces delays in program execution. By measuring execution time of certain code sections, software can infer if it is being traced. However, sophisticated debuggers can minimize overhead, so timing checks should be combined with other techniques for better effectiveness.

Related Searches